The Income-Related Monthly Adjustment Amount sliding scale is a set of statutory percentage-based tables. These tables are used to adjust Medicare premiums based on adjusted gross income. 2. IRMAA is an additional amount that some people might have to pay along with their Medicare premium.Most Medicare enrollees pay the standard premium amounts for Part B (outpatient care) and Part D (prescription drugs). Yet an estimated 7% of Medicare’s 64.3 million beneficiaries end up paying ...Jun 16, 2020 · The CMS calculates the IRMAA. When a person makes more than the allowed income amount, Medicare may add an IRMAA to the Part B premium, Part D premium, or both. The amounts are based on a person ...

For example, Social Security would use tax returns from 2022 to determine your IRMAA in 2024. If you are unsure why you are paying an IRMAA, you can call the Social Security hotline at 800-772-1213. IRMAA is paid by every participant with relatively high income. IRMAA will also be referred to as “higher Medi-care premiums.” IRMAA is generally based on adjusted gross income (AGI) from Form 1040 plus tax-exempt interest, hereafter referred to as modified AGI (MAGI), for the second-previous year.1 The
